Strategic Investments Driving the Future of Manufacturing

The announcement of a more than $2 billion investment to expand North American manufacturing capacity marks a turning point for companies looking to harness modern technology. The scale of this investment illustrates an industry-wide effort to incorporate robotics, advanced analytics, and artificial intelligence into everyday operations. As the new facilities take shape, businesses are seeing firsthand how large-scale investments in technology can streamline production and enhance product development. For example, the planned advanced manufacturing site in Warren, Ohio, spanning about 1.2 million square feet, stands as a testament to the integration of modern automation technologies with traditional manufacturing practices.

This shift is not just about building larger facilities; it’s about creating an ecosystem where technology and production processes coalesce to produce smarter, faster results. With more than 900 jobs expected to emerge in industrial automation and advanced manufacturing, the investment underscores a significant pivot towards employing sophisticated tools to handle complex operations. This trend emphasizes the importance of adapting to technological advancements, thereby providing a competitive edge in market innovation and operational efficiency.

Enhancing Supply Chain Effectiveness Through Automation

The development of an automated distribution center, which will feature robotics and AI-powered logistics, signals a commitment to modernizing supply chains. The integration of such technologies can drastically reduce operation times and minimize human error. In a highly intertwined global market, optimizing logistics isn’t just a luxury—it’s a necessity. Case studies from various industries indicate that even a 10% improvement in supply chain efficiency can lead to noticeable cost savings and faster delivery times.

The efficient distribution network associated with the new investment allows manufacturers to control quality, speed, and consistency from production to end-user delivery. These improvements directly impact the bottom line by enhancing responsiveness and simplifying complex logistics networks. For businesses looking to improve business efficiency with automation, investing in automated systems versus traditional methods offers measurable performance enhancements supported by current operational research.

Historically, similar moves in supply chain reconfiguration have resulted in improved delivery metrics and customer satisfaction ratings. The success observed in industries like automotive manufacturing, where the introduction of automated parts distribution has harmonized workflows and reduced overhead costs, further reinforces the benefits of embracing these innovations.

Implementing Automation Strategies in Your Business

The rapid adoption of automation technologies across industries presents both a challenge and an opportunity for businesses. Companies of all sizes are reimagining their operational workflows by integrating solutions that improve business efficiency with automation. To successfully adopt these measures, organizations should focus on a multi-stage approach:

First, it is crucial to assess current workflows to identify repetitive tasks that are time-consuming or error-prone. For instance, if a business spends significant hours manually updating inventory or processing orders, installing automated systems can help reallocate these resources to more value-driven work. In many cases, the initial phase involves conducting a comprehensive audit of business processes, supported by analytics tools that provide performance benchmarks and clear opportunities for intervention.

Next, determining the right technology partner is key. Collaborations with experienced software development agencies can assist in integrating customized automation solutions that resonate with a company’s strategic goals. Several industries have shared success stories where a detailed evaluation of their processes led to targeted implementations; one study noted a 25% reduction in operational costs following the adoption of automated solutions.

Another essential strategy involves planning scalable solutions. Automation benefits become more pronounced when implemented incrementally, allowing businesses to adapt to emerging trends. Over time, these incremental changes build a robust infrastructure that supports further digital transformation efforts. As companies continue to integrate these systems, maintaining data security and operational flexibility becomes paramount, ensuring that technological enhancements do not compromise customer trust or operational integrity.

FAQ

Q1: How can small businesses start integrating automation without a large investment?

A1: Many small businesses can begin with affordable, off-the-shelf automation tools available in the market. Starting with basic process automation, such as email marketing automation or simple inventory management software, can help introduce the benefits gradually and provide data for further investments.

Q2: What challenges might companies face when transitioning to automated systems?

A2: Common challenges include the initial cost of technology integration, training staff to adapt to new systems, and ensuring cybersecurity measures are in place. However, careful planning and phased implementation help mitigate these challenges effectively.

Q3: Are there industries where automation has proven particularly beneficial?

A3: Industries such as manufacturing, logistics, and retail have experienced notable improvements in productivity and operational efficiency due to automation. The ongoing technological shift in these sectors shows that strategic investment in automation can result in significant cost savings and performance enhancements.
